Softball Recap: East River Falcons vs. Osceola Kowboys

Suggested Video

East River owes their pitching crew a big pat on the back after their performance on Tuesday. They came out on top against the Osceola Kowboys by a score of 4-0. For the Falcons, this counts as revenge for the 13-3 victory the Kowboys walked away with the last time they faced one another back in May of 2022.

Not much got past Katherine Sanchez, who gave up just two hits and racked up 14 Ks to keep Osceola off the board. Sanchez has been nothing but reliable on the mound: she hasn't given up more than two walks in 15 consecutive appearances.

At the plate, Tru Mastro was excellent, going 2-for-4 with two RBI and one double. The team also got some help courtesy of Gaby Angueira, who went 1-for-2 with one run and one double.

East River has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won ten of their last 11 games. That's provided a nice bump to their 16-6 record this season. Those w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 8.5 runs over those games. As for Osceola, their def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-9.

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. East River will challenge Windermere Prep at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. The Lakers will roll in looking for their tenth straight victory, something the Falcons surely won't give up without a fight. As for Osceola, they will take on Melbourne at 6:00 p.m. on Wednesday. The Kowboys' pitchers better be ready for this one: the Bulldogs have averaged an impressive 6.8 runs per game this season.
